Xylem Ablaze

He climbed atop
an oak on fire
Its sap transformed  
by flames concealed  

Each branch he passed
a year he traded
For what’s unseen
— by heat congealed

The Scab, Or For Donna

Covered thinly, by a bloody clot.
Unhealed.
Congealed.
Unwelcome obligations to eat, sleep, dress
fulfilled.
That your body is still here
is the best that can be said 
of this,
the first year.

Battle's Glory

O'er valley and dale
  flashed lightning and hail
Brass buttons, glimpses of steel
 
Soon bullets whizzed by
  cringing lads' shell-shocked eyes
Severed heads seen to spin and reel

Peach-fuzzed cheeks without beard
  a frantic youth's cry seared
skies the color of blood congealed

Sharp pains split his chest
  as he sobbed up the rest
of a life lost to fortune's wheel

Scapular Burning

What are we but relics
of time gone by

Where painful encounters
stay undenied

The wounds may scar over
but never heal

As memory is martyred
its blood congealed

New skin tries to cover
what sutures can’t hide

Each moment recovered
a falsehood decried

With strength built on pillars
of fortunes disdain

From deep in the shadows
—our essence remains

Simple Zen

time, fickle mistress, turned away,
as a child runs to play,

next time as we're looking down
the child's grown and no where found,

and as life's minutes slowly tick
our rushing moments never stick,

a smile, a touch, a windblown field
are left in a past so soon congealed,

grasping desperate for the years
burning older through our tears,

laughter soon a gasping sigh
played out music, fading cry,

so turn your eyes to breaking dawn
life explained in a small dog's yawn...
